Quinoa-Stuffed Bell Peppers
These Quinoa-Stuffed Bell Peppers are an oldie but a goodie! Green bell peppers are stuffed with a flavorful quinoa and veggie mixture, oven-baked to perfection, and finished with toasted almonds. These stuffed peppers look and taste impressive without requiring much effort. For an extra boost of protein and flavor, add a pound of extra-lean ground beef or turkey to the filling for an easy, satisfying, and well-rounded weeknight dinner!

Crockpot Chicken
This flavor-packed Crockpot Chicken is one of the most frequently made recipes in my kitchen… I make it at least once a week! Just add chicken breasts, seasonings, and bone broth, then let the slow cooker do the work before shredding and serving. It’s one of those easy weeknight dinner ideas you can reinvent throughout the week, whether you keep it simple with rice and veggies or switch things up with chicken tacos, quesadillas, or a hearty salad.
